Corduroy Holiday Outfits From Kohl’s
Holiday outfits don’t all have to be sequins or red, green, silver, or gold. I like wearing something warm, stylish, and versatile. Versatility is my main objective for holiday wear. I want to be able to wear my clothing more than one or two times during the holidays, so I look for items that can be worn now and later. The corduroy Seabourne High Rise Wide-Leg Trouser Jeans look fabulous and are on trend with their patch pockets. I love corduroy, and this color is one I will wear all winter.
This Popcorn Stitching Cardigan is gorgeous and can be worn buttoned or open. Navy and white might not be your choice for a Christmas outfit, but it will look perfect for Thanksgiving. You can easily make this outfit Christmasy by adding a festive pin to the cardigan. I’m wearing a large cardigan, but I think a medium would have been a better fit.

Accessories finish an outfit and make it look put together. The pins above would make a big difference in the outfit’s look, and I never leave the house without a handbag. Most of my handbags are a caramel color since they go with anything. This tote bag has three compartments so you can keep your items separated.

Floral Holiday Outfits From Kohl’s
Now, let’s talk about festive wear that looks more Christmas-like. The velvet trousers elevate this tonal, deep teal look.
The Floral Crewneck Raglan Sweater looks perfect with the velvet trousers. I also tried the sweater on with a pair of jeans, and it looked great. The sweater is extremely soft, and I like the wide-ribbed hem. The sweater is available in several colors, and you’ll want to check out the Quicksd Placed Larissa. I love the floral design on it.

First off, these Velvet Wide-Leg Trousers are gorgeous, lightweight and flowy, and too long for me. I have no idea why they are long on me since I always wear a 32″ inseam. I’m going to try them with another pair of heels. If that doesn’t work, I’ll turn the hem up one time and secure it with some hemming tape. Either way, these trousers WILL be worn for the holidays this year!
